L-R student killed in wreck
Student was traveling to Florida with fianc?e to see family for Thanksgiving.

By KIM GILLILAND Record Staff Writer
Saturday, November 27, 2004


A Lenoir-Rhyne College student was killed in a single-car accident while driving to Melbourne, Fla., for Thanksgiving.

Brandon Killingsworth, a 21-year-old junior, was on his way home to see family, said Anita Johnson Gwin, vice president for student affairs.

The accident occurred about 4:10 a.m. Wednesday on Interstate 95 near Walterboro, S.C., Gwin said. Killingsworth was traveling south when his 2004 Chevrolet pickup truck drifted into the median and struck a tree, said Lance Cpl. P.J. Brouthers of the South Carolina Highway Patrol.

Killingsworth was pronounced dead at the scene. His fiancée, 19-year-old Shannon Brophy of Baltimore, suffered non-life-threatening injuries and is hospitalized at the Medical University of South Carolina in Charleston, Gwin said.

Brophy is also a student at L-R.

“I knew Brandon best from the press box at L-R football games,” said Andrew Weisner, L-R pastor. “He was a very kind fellow, very dear. He was full of kindness, very friendly and had a warm and welcoming smile.”

“He was probably the nicest guy in the world; he had no enemies,” Gwin said. “It’s sad.”

Killingsworth was a member of the Pi Kappa Phi fraternity, an intramural referee and a member of the athletic events staff at the college.
